This is the image of the Saiva saint Manikkavachakar. The raised right hand is in china - mudra (the index finger and thumb are joined); while in the left he holds the Tiruvachkam manuscript bearing a mutilated inscription. The hair is short and he is dressed like a monk with ringlets falling over the forehead.

  • Title: Manikkavachakar
  • Date Created: 12th Century CE
  • Location: South India
  • Physical Dimensions: Ht. 50.2 cm., Wd. 21.8 cm., Dep. 20.8 cm.
  • Medium: Bronze
  • Dynasty: Late Chola
